Transaction 21e2679414e4f56807b5cd041f7526483407974ee2e1004777647485a12fb148
1 Input
1 Output
-
21e2679414e4f56807b5cd041f7526483407974ee2e1004777647485a12fb148:0
- value
- 35008
- script pubkey
- OP_0 OP_PUSHBYTES_20 42c24421deefa0b13e6858f9bedb0113e0abf514
- address
- bc1qgtpyggw7a7stz0ngtrumakcpz0s2hag5wsp5q5